Abstract

The invention provides an overhead type automotive air conditioning device. The overhead type automotive air conditioning device comprises an accommodating chamber, an exterior heat exchange assembly, interior heat exchange assemblies, a compressor assembly and a control assembly, wherein the exterior heat exchange assembly and the interior heat exchange assemblies are arranged in a front-end chamber; the front-end chamber comprises an exterior heat exchange cavity for accommodating the exterior heat exchange assembly and interior heat exchange cavities for accommodating the interior heat exchange assemblies, the exterior heat exchange cavity is formed in the middle of the front-end chamber, and the interior heat exchange cavities are formed in the left side and the right side of the exterior heat exchange cavity; the compressor assembly and the control assembly are both arranged in a rear-end chamber. The invention further provides an automobile. According to the overhead type automotive air conditioning device and the automobile, the structure of the air conditioning device is compact, so that the roof space can be saved, and the weight of the whole air conditioning device is reduced. Meanwhile, waste gas emitted from the front-end chamber can enter the rear-end chamber for cooling or heat preservation of the compressor assembly and the control assembly, and the reliability of the air conditioning device is improved.

Description

technical field [0001] The invention relates to the technical field of air conditioners, in particular to a top-mounted automobile air conditioner and an automobile. Background technique [0002] Most of the air conditioners used in passenger cars and urban buses are top-mounted and placed flat on the roof of the car. The traditional top-mounted passenger car air conditioners are divided into three chambers: front, middle and rear. The compressor, control unit and power supply system are located in the middle chamber, and the heat exchanger inside the vehicle is arranged in the rear chamber. This kind of arrangement makes the volume of the air conditioner larger, takes up a lot of space on the roof, and the air conditioner is heavier, resulting in increased energy consumption during the operation of the vehicle, especially for pure electric buses, which will shorten the cruising range.
